What is the Supplemental Application for International Students?
The Supplemental Application for International Students is a crucial document in the international student application process. This form serves to gather essential information that admissions committees require to make informed decisions. Key personal details such as the applicant's legal name, I-20 status, and other identifying information are needed to assess eligibility and readiness for study in the U.S.

Who is eligible to submit the Supplemental Application for International Students?
International students who are applying to educational institutions using this specific form are eligible to submit it. You should verify the admission requirements of your chosen institution.
What supporting documents are required with this application?
Typically, supporting documents may include proof of identity, academic transcripts, proof of English proficiency, and any other documents as specified by the institution. Ensure you check university guidelines.
Are there specific deadlines for submitting this form?
Yes, many institutions have set deadlines for international student applications, including this form. Review the admission calendar of your chosen institution for exact dates.
